admin 管理员组

文章数量: 1086019


2024年3月11日发(作者:oracle主目录名怎么找)

如何运用前端开发技术实现网页的轮播效果

如何运用前端开发技术实现网页轮播效果

近年来,随着互联网的普及,网页设计已成为各行业不可或缺的一部分。在网

页设计中,轮播效果是提高用户体验和页面吸引力的重要组成部分。本文将介绍如

何运用前端开发技术实现网页的轮播效果。

一、了解轮播效果的原理

在实现轮播效果前,我们首先需要了解它的原理。轮播效果实质上是通过动态

切换图片或内容的展示区域,让用户可以浏览多个相关内容。一般而言,轮播效果

有以下几种主要形式:基于图片的轮播、基于内容的轮播以及基于混合内容的轮播。

在实际开发中,我们可以根据需求选择合适的轮播形式,然后运用前端开发技术来

实现。

二、使用HTML和CSS构建轮播容器

轮播容器是展示轮播内容的区域,我们可以使用HTML和CSS来构建。首先,

我们需要创建一个容器元素,可以是div或者ul等标签。然后,通过CSS来设置

容器的样式,包括宽度、高度、边框、背景、位置等。此外,我们还可以通过

CSS来设置容器的动画效果,如渐变、缩放等。

三、使用JavaScript控制轮播效果

在实际开发中,我们通常会使用JavaScript来控制轮播效果。首先,我们需要

通过JavaScript获取轮播容器的信息,如宽度、高度、图片数量等。然后,我们可

以通过编写JavaScript代码来实现以下功能:

1. 切换图片或内容:通过设置定时器,在一定的时间间隔内切换展示区域的图

片或内容。可以通过修改容器的style属性或者添加CSS类来实现切换效果。

2. 自动播放和控制:可以通过设置定时器来自动播放轮播内容,并提供播放、

暂停、上一张、下一张等按钮来控制轮播过程。

3. 循环轮播:在切换到最后一张图片或内容后,可以通过设置初始位置进行循

环轮播,使得用户在一直浏览相关内容。

4. 响应式布局:根据不同设备的屏幕大小,可以通过设置媒体查询和适配方案

来实现响应式布局,以适应不同屏幕的显示效果。

四、优化轮播效果的性能

为了提高页面加载速度和用户体验,我们可以对轮播效果进行一些性能优化。

具体而言,我们可以通过以下方式来优化轮播效果的性能:

1. 图片优化:对轮播图片进行压缩和裁剪,以减小文件大小和提高加载速度。

可以使用图片编辑工具或者在线压缩网站来进行处理。

2. 惰性加载:在页面加载时,只加载用户可视区域内的轮播内容,而不是全部

内容。可以使用JavaScript的懒加载技术来实现。

3. 缓存技术:利用浏览器缓存机制,将常用的轮播资源缓存到本地,以减少页

面的请求次数和加载时间。

4. 代码优化:通过对JavaScript和CSS代码进行合并、压缩和缓存,以减小文

件大小和提高执行效率。还可以使用异步加载和延迟加载技术,减少页面加载时间。

综上所述,运用前端开发技术实现网页轮播效果并不复杂,只需了解轮播效果

的原理,使用HTML和CSS构建轮播容器,通过JavaScript控制轮播效果,并对

其进行性能优化。实际开发中,我们还可以根据需求添加一些特效和交互功能,以

提高用户的浏览体验。通过不断学习和实践,我们可以设计出更加吸引人的网页轮

播效果,并为用户带来更好的使用体验。


本文标签: 轮播 效果 加载